Yadong Wang is a scholar working on Atmospheric Science, Geophysics and Artificial Intelligence. According to data from OpenAlex, Yadong Wang has authored 32 papers receiving a total of 893 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 21 papers in Atmospheric Science, 15 papers in Geophysics and 6 papers in Artificial Intelligence. Recurrent topics in Yadong Wang's work include Meteorological Phenomena and Simulations (18 papers), Precipitation Measurement and Analysis (13 papers) and Seismic Waves and Analysis (8 papers). Yadong Wang is often cited by papers focused on Meteorological Phenomena and Simulations (18 papers), Precipitation Measurement and Analysis (13 papers) and Seismic Waves and Analysis (8 papers).
